


3-Card Combination
Embracing Potential and Nurturing Growth
This combination of cards highlights a powerful interplay between ambition, creativity, and practicality. The Two of Wands invites exploration and planning, while the Queens embody nurturing energy and passion, suggesting a balanced approach to personal and professional endeavors.
Two of Wands
Upright: planning, future, progress, decisions
Reversed: fear of change, playing it safe, bad planning
Queen of Wands
Upright: courage, confidence, independence, social butterfly
Reversed: selfishness, jealousy, demanding, temperamental
Queen of Pentacles
Upright: practicality, creature comforts, financial security, nurturing
Reversed: self-centeredness, jealousy, smothering
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they signify a time of growth and exploration, where future visions are being crafted with both passion and practicality. The Two of Wands urges you to consider your options and take bold steps, while the Queen of Wands inspires confidence and creativity in your pursuits. Meanwhile, the Queen of Pentacles reinforces the importance of grounding your ambitions in reality, ensuring that you nurture your resources and relationships as you move forward.
Two of Wands Reversed
When the Two of Wands is reversed, it may indicate a fear of taking risks or indecision about the path ahead. You might feel stuck or overwhelmed by choices, leading to a sense of stagnation. This card suggests a need to reassess your goals and find clarity before advancing.
Queen of Wands Reversed
The Queen of Wands reversed can signify a lack of confidence or a struggle with self-identity. You may feel uninspired or unable to channel your creativity effectively, resulting in a disconnect with your passions. It's a reminder to reconnect with your inner fire and assert your unique presence.
Queen of Pentacles Reversed
When the Queen of Pentacles is reversed, it can indicate neglect of practical matters or an imbalance in nurturing energy. You might be overly focused on material success at the expense of emotional and physical well-being. This card encourages you to find ways to nurture yourself and those around you.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the energy becomes chaotic and disjointed, suggesting a time of confusion and lack of direction. Ambitions may feel thwarted, and there might be struggles in managing both creative and practical aspects of life. It’s a call to reevaluate priorities and restore balance before moving forward.
Love & Relationships
In love and relationships, this combination reversed may indicate communication issues or emotional disconnects. There might be a struggle to balance personal desires with nurturing your partner, leading to tension. Focus on open dialogue and reconnecting with each other's needs to foster harmony.
Career & Finances
In the realm of career and finances, this reading suggests potential stagnation or misalignment with your true passions. You may feel unfulfilled or uncertain about your next steps, which could impact your productivity. Take the time to reassess your goals and seek guidance from mentors or trusted colleagues.
Advice
The advice here is to take a step back and reflect on your current situation, both personally and professionally. Identify any fears or blockages that may be holding you back from pursuing your true potential. Embrace a balanced approach by integrating your creative passions with practical actions, ensuring you nurture both your ambitions and well-being.
